Man shot in Brighton Park

A man was shot in the Brighton Park neighborhood on the Southwest Side Tuesday afternoon.

About 2:40 p.m., someone broke the window of the 23-year-old’s home and he saw a beige car drive away down his block, police said.

The man gathered some friends, and they found the car in the 4400 block of South Talman, police said. When the 23-year-old walked up to the vehicle, someone inside shot him in the leg.

He was taken to Mount Sinai Hospital, where his condition stabilized, police said.
